                  I think plenty of conservative decisions have been made.

                  No Stokes - very conservative. Yet Prior, who has played the same amount of cricket, walks back in despite not even being in the side in our last two Tests.

                  Prior ahead of Buttler speaks for itself.

                  Ali is a hugely conservative pick. Not very good at either batting or bowling but does a bit of both so he's in too.

                  Woakes. Dear me.

                  Plunkett has apparently been bowling well (and fast) but England did well under Flower because we brought new/young players through, not bringing in 29 year olds who've been outcasts for 7 years. Onions - who thrives in early English summer conditions - is overlooked always because he would be a "backward looking pick". So what the **** is Plunkett?

                  Shocker of a squad. We'll probably beat Sri Lanka regardless but I hate the look of the squad.
